Sharepoint 2007 中基于表单的会员资格面临问题吗?

发布于 2024-10-31 14:11:43 字数 624 浏览 3 评论 0原文

我已按照 此处 在 shrepoint 2007 中配置表单身份验证的确切步骤,但我我无法使用该用户登录。我检查了我的连接字符串是否正确,提供程序也是最新的,那么问题是什么?

我对同一主题还有另一个问题。假设我已使用 asp.net 配置应用程序在 sql server 数据库中配置了成员资格数据库。

假设我创建了一个用户“XYZ”。当然,这将被插入到会员数据库中。但是,此用户(“XYZ”)是否也会添加到 Active Directory 用户中?或不。

如果不是,那么在共享点站点(来自人员和组)中创建用户时,它将如何解析我在会员数据库中输入的“XYZ”用户?

因为正如我所解释的,我已经从 ASP.NET 配置数据库创建了用户“lalit”,我在会员数据库中找到了该用户。因为我已经给了该网站的连接字符串,我的会员数据库。当我通过人员和组选项(从网站设置)为网站添加新用户时,我收到错误消息“未找到用户匹配”,类似这样。所以我在活动目录中创建了名为“lalit”的用户,然后它就解决了。但为什么我需要创建“lalit”作为活动目录的用户?或者,如果存在活动目录用户,为什么需要创建成员数据库......?

I had followed the exact steps to configure form authentication in shrepoint 2007 from here but i am unable to login with the user. I checked that my connection string is right, providers are also current so what should be the issue ?

I have another question regarding same topic.let say i have configured the membership database in my sql server database by using the asp.net configuration application.

say I have created a user "XYZ". certainly this will inserted into the membership database. but, will this user ("XYZ") also added in Active directory users ? or not.

If not then while creating the user in sharepoint site (from people and group) How it will resolve the "XYZ" user which i entered in membership database?

because as i explained i have created user "lalit" from asp.net configuration database , i found this user in membership database. where as i have given connection string to that site, of my membership database. and when I went to add new user for the site through People and group option (from site settings) , I got error message "No user match found" something like this. So i created user in active directory with name " lalit" then it resolved. but why should i need to create the "lalit" as user to active directory ? Or why then need to create the membership database if active directory users are there ...?

如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。

扫码二维码加入Web技术交流群

发布评论

需要 登录 才能够评论, 你可以免费 注册 一个本站的账号。

评论(1

握住我的手 2024-11-07 14:11:43

您需要使用提供商作为前缀,例如,如果您的提供商成员​​资格名称是 MOSSProvider,则当您将用户添加到组时,您必须将其添加为“MOSSProvider:用户名”,并且您必须已配置您的站点FAB。检查备用访问映射操作来执行此操作。

You need to use the provider as a prefix, for example, if your provider membership name is MOSSProvider, when you add a user to a group, you have to add it as "MOSSProvider:username", also you must have configured your site with FAB. Check Alternate Access Mapping operation for doing that.

~没有更多了~
我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
原文